TPW Investment Management (TPWIM) was founded in early 2018 by Jay Pelosky, CIO, and Jamie Gardiner, COO. Jay and Jamie met and started working together in late 2010 at a prior firm called JAForlines Global where Jamie was the first employee and Jay was a Senior Advisor on portfolio strategy and asset allocation. Jay and Jamie were both members of the investment committee, worked closely on portfolio construction and marketed together.

Jay Pelosky

Jay Pelosky

CO-FOUNDER, CIO

Jay is responsible for management of all TPWIM’s global asset allocation & portfolio strategy, leads the research activities of the investment team, and produces numerous written market and research commentaries. In addition he is a frequent speaker at industry conference and a reoccurring guest on television (Bloomberg, RealVision, etc).

He has over 30 years of buy and sell side investment experience in close to 50 countries around the globe. For the past 15 years he has invested his personal capital in an ETF based, global multi asset investment process. In 2011 he launched Pelosky Global Strategies (PGS), an investment advisory boutique advising Institutions, Hedge Funds and RIAs on portfolio strategy and asset allocation. Prior to PGS he was a Morgan Stanley Strategist & MD. At Morgan Stanley Asset Management, he launched single country and regional funds and served as PM. As a Morgan Stanley sell side strategist, he created the Firm’s Global Asset Allocation, Global Equity & Global Emerging Markets Strategy products and was a top ranked II Strategist in multiple categories.

James Gardiner

James Gardiner

Co-Founder, COO

Jamie is responsible for management of all TPWIM’s operations, business development, and partnerships. In addition as a member of the portfolio team he is responsible for ETF research and selection as well as portfolio construction across TPWIM’s product suite.

Former COO of one of the industry’s leading ETF Strategist firms JAForlines Global, Jamie helped lead JFG from a startup to one of the industry’s leading ETF Strategists, which was acquired in late 2017. As COO he successfully launched the Firm’s Global Macro Tactical Allocation Solutions across SMA, Mutual fund, CIT, and model delivery vehicles. He also oversaw aspects of the business including product development, sales, marketing, trading, and operations. While at JAForlines he spent 8 years on the portfolio management team. JFG’s flagship Global Tactical Allocation portfolio ranked in the top decile over the 3 year period ending 12/31/17 among Morningstar Tactical Mutual Funds. The firm was also named Envestnet’s Strategist of the Year in 2016 and was a finalist again for 2018.
